Lotte Chemical
One of Korea's largest petrochemical makers, anchored in NCC-based olefins and resins but sitting in the middle of a structural down-cycle — a Chinese capacity glut has collapsed spreads, driving a 2024 operating loss of KRW 895bn (a third straight loss year). So the question is not a commodity-chem recovery but the success of its pivot: localizing four electrolyte solvents (~KRW 350bn invested) and shifting weight toward battery-materials subsidiary Lotte Energy Materials, while its U.S. Lake Charles ethane-cracker JV secures low-cost ethane-based competitiveness. - Basic Chemicals exports & domestic (ethylene, PE/PP, BTX, MEG) High confidence
The origin of losses and the scale axis — FY2025 Basic Chemicals revenue was KRW 12,480.1bn (68% of company sales), 65% of it exports (KRW 8,159.3bn). The high-value axis defending commodity weakness — FY2025 Advanced Materials revenue KRW 5,086.7bn, 81% exports (KRW 4,115.8bn). - Naphtha (GS Caltex, HD Hyundai Oilbank, etc.) High confidence
The single feedstock holding half of costs — naphtha, the base input for the NCC, was KRW 5,015.1bn of purchases in FY2025, 50.8% of total. The aromatics feedstock axis — mixed xylene and related are sourced from Itochu and others, KRW 841.9bn in FY2025 (8.5% of purchases). The core bet to escape commodity chemicals — a consolidated subsidiary controlled via the 2023 Iljin Materials acquisition, entering the battery-materials chain with copper foil (Elecfoil). FY2025 battery-materials revenue was KRW 677.5bn (down from KRW 902.3bn on the EV air-pocket). The Lake Charles ethane-cracker JV in Louisiana (~1Mt ethylene/yr, 50:50 with Westlake) — feeding on cheap shale-based ethane for a cost edge over Asian naphtha, a key margin defense in the down-cycle; Westlake bought up to 50% in 2019/2022.

The core question for Lotte Chemical is a race between the depth of the commodity-chem down-cycle and the speed of its pivot. Chinese ethylene expansions created a global glut that pushed spreads below breakeven, producing a 2024 operating loss of KRW 895bn — a third consecutive loss year. Recovery hinges less on self-help than on China's expansion cycle peaking and older capacity closing, so the company focuses on what it controls: cost (low-cost Lake Charles ethane) and portfolio shift (localized electrolyte solvents, Lotte Energy Materials). In graph terms the ripple runs from olefins into downstream resins, and until the battery-materials axis becomes material to earnings, the petrochemical cycle dominates the stock.
